B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specifically formulated for feed-grade use and analyzed to meet stringent quality and security requirements. BHT is often a lipophilic natural and organic compound that is definitely mostly made use of as an antioxidant in different industrial apps. In animal nourishment, BHT FEED GRADE TEST is extensively employed to prevent the oxidation of fats and oils in animal feed, thus preserving the nutritional value and lengthening the shelf life of the feed. Oxidized fats not only eliminate nutritional efficacy but can also create damaging compounds, impacting the health and progress of livestock. The inclusion of BHT in feed needs arduous tests to ensure it adheres to regulatory benchmarks and is safe for intake by animals, which eventually enters the human food chain. The screening protocols normally evaluate the purity, efficacy, and likely residues in animal tissues.
Another significant compound during the chemical domain is Pentachloropyridine. This compound is a chlorinated spinoff of pyridine and has garnered interest due to its utility being an intermediate in the synthesis of agrochemicals, dyes, and prescription drugs. Its high degree of chlorination makes it a potent compound, which must be handled with treatment as a result of prospective toxicity and environmental considerations. Pentachloropyridine serves as being a making block in chemical synthesis, allowing for chemists to create additional advanced molecules Which may be Employed in herbicides, insecticides, or maybe specialty polymers. The dealing with and disposal of Pentachloropyridine are regulated, given its possible environmental persistence and bioaccumulation hazard. Industries working with this compound often undertake closed-program manufacturing solutions and demanding safety protocols to minimize exposure.
M-Phenylene Diamine, normally abbreviated as MPD, is definitely an aromatic amine that options prominently in the production of aramid fibers, that happen to be properly-recognized for their heat resistance and energy. Kevlar and Nomex, Employed in system armor and hearth-resistant clothes, respectively, are made working with MPD as being a important precursor. The compound by itself is made up of a benzene ring with two amino teams in the meta positions, which makes it well suited for developing polymers with appealing thermal and mechanical Qualities. M-Phenylene Diamine (MPD) can also be Employed in the dye marketplace, particularly in hair dyes as well as other beauty programs, While its use has actually been curtailed in some areas due to basic safety fears. When manufacturing goods made up of MPD, proper occupational protection methods are essential to protect personnel from prolonged exposure, which could lead on to pores and skin sensitization or other health concerns.
O-Phenylene Diamine (OPDA), while structurally much like MPD, differs while in the positioning of your amino teams, which significantly influences its chemical reactivity and software. OPDA is frequently utilized from the manufacture of dyes and pigments, the place it contributes on the formation of vivid colours which might be stable and very long-lasting. It is also Utilized in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s job in corrosion inhibitors and rubber chemical compounds additional highlights its flexibility. Nonetheless, comparable to other aromatic amines, OPDA is additionally affiliated with toxicity pitfalls, and thus, its use is very carefully managed and monitored. The significance of suitable handling, acceptable storage, and adequate protecting steps cannot be overstated when addressing OPDA in almost any industrial location.
Pinacolone is yet another noteworthy compound with many different apps. It is just a ketone Together with the molecular formula C6H12O and it is employed principally as an intermediate while in the synthesis of pesticides and herbicides, particularly inside the production of triazole fungicides and particular plant expansion regulators. Pinacolone’s construction features a tertiary butyl group, which contributes to its unique reactivity in organic synthesis. Further than agriculture, it can even be found in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its ability to endure nucleophilic substitution and condensation reactions, rendering it a precious reagent in laboratory and industrial processes. Whilst it can be considerably less hazardous than a lot of the Beforehand talked about compounds, protection safety measures remain important to mitigate any threats affiliated with its volatility and likely irritant Houses.
two-Heptanone is actually a ketone that The natural way occurs in some vegetation and can be located in compact quantities in human sweat and specific animal secretions. It is often Employed in the fragrance and taste industries because of its enjoyable, fruity odor. Furthermore, 2-Heptanone has found programs for a solvent and intermediate in natural and organic synthesis. Apparently, analysis has advised that it might Enjoy a task in chemical signaling, specially in insects, where it functions being an alarm pheromone. This has resulted in its analyze in pest Handle tactics and behavioral science. Industrially, two-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its reasonably lower toxicity makes it ideal for use in purchaser products and solutions, Whilst proper labeling and handling Directions are always mandated.
